Weekend Matinee

The HFA continues its specially priced screenings of films for our younger viewers and accompanying adults. Drawing from the Harvard Film Archive collection and beyond, this series of classic and contemporary films are screened in their original formats and languages. Curated especially for teenagers, this season focuses on the visually stunning, meticulous anime of Makoto Shinkai (b. 1973)—who just released his latest sumptuous creation, Weathering With You. One of his early influences—Hayao Miyazaki’s astounding Castle of the Sky—is also featured.

 

All Weekend Matinee screenings are admission-free for holders of a valid Cambridge Public Library card!
